Incubation
01

incubation

the controlled maintenance of a specific temperature; fostering optimal conditions for the development of organisms, processes, or materials
example
Exemples
The scientist adjusted the incubation temperature for the bacterial cultures.
Le scientifique a ajusté la température d'incubation pour les cultures bactériennes.
Proper incubation is crucial for the successful hatching of eggs.
Une incubation appropriée est cruciale pour la réussite de l'éclosion des œufs.
02

incubation, couvaison

sitting on eggs so as to hatch them by the warmth of the body
03

incubation

the initial stage of exposure to an infectious disease which is the time it takes for the infection to develop and for one to notice the first signs and symptoms
